King Belieal wrote:Water is a major component of our body. Taking it even in excess doesn't have any harmful effects on the body.


That's not true. You can actually drink too much water, which messes up the balance of electroyltes (certain minerals in your body) which can cause muscle cramps, headaches, dizziness and brain fog. If you're drinking a lot of water you need to make sure you get some salt too.
